#BBDF89 Hex Color Code

#BBDF89

The Hexadecimal Color #BBDF89 is a contrast shade of Light Green. #BBDF89 RGB value is rgb(187, 223, 137). RGB Color Model of #BBDF89 consists of 73% red, 87% green and 53% blue. HSL color Mode of #BBDF89 has 85°(degrees) Hue, 57% Saturation and 71% Lightness. #BBDF89 color has an wavelength of 566.48148n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BBDF89 is #CCFF99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BBDF89 is #BD8. The Closest Color to #BBDF89 is #90EE90. Official Name of #BBDF89 Hex Code is Feijoa.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BBDF89 is 16 Cyan 0 Magenta 39 Yellow 13 Black and #BBDF89 CMY is 16, 0, 39.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BBDF89 is hsl(85,57,71,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(85, 39, 87).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BBDF89 is 51.4, 65.15, 33.53.
Hex8 Value of #BBDF89 is #BBDF89FF. Decimal Value of #BBDF89 is 12312457 and Octal Value of #BBDF89 is 56757611. Binary Value of #BBDF89 is 10111011, 11011111, 10001001 and Android of #BBDF89 is 4290502537 / 0xffbbdf89.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BBDF89 is 0.342, 0.434, 0.434 and YIQ Color Space of #BBDF89 is 202.432, 6.1794, -34.3772.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BBDF89 is 60.21, 74.63, 34.01.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BBDF89 is 84.56, -26.09, 38.32.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BBDF89 is 84.56, -17.34, 55.95.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BBDF89 is 84.56, 46.36, 124.25. Hunter Lab variable of #BBDF89 is 80.72, -27.58, 31.87.

Various Color Shades of #BBDF89

To get 25% Saturated #BBDF89 Color, you need to convert the hex color #BBDF89 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#BBDF89 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BBDF89

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
